Re: 11th anniversary drop. July 12th

Posted: Mon Jul 23, 2018 4:08 pm
by akum6n
If you heat up the 'stretched' armor and let it cool for a day or two, it should go back to its 'raw' size and shape.

I have a very difficult time fitting the limb guards over the hands, unless I heat them up first.

by kranix
Rangerman wrote:Anyone noticing that the fit functions for the axis joints aren't as tight as they used to be. I reconfigured the new Argen into the form shown on the blog and anywhere axis joints connected to anything else the fits were loose. Sometimes ridiculously, free spinningly loose.


I've been noticing that for a few drops, but it seems to be fixed by putting everything through a heatbox, disassembled, and letting things cool for a bit before heating up just the socketed parts.
